The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in Minnesota

Minnesota River at Savage affecting Hennepin, Scott, Carver and Dakota Counties.

Minnesota River at Morton affecting Renville and Redwood Counties.

Minnesota River at Montevideo affecting Yellow Medicine, Chippewa and Lac qui Parle Counties.

  • Water levels have been steadily falling on the Minnesota, but currently remain at minor flood stage at Savage, Morton, and Montevideo. Precipitation will return to the forecast on Saturday and may be heavy across southern Minnesota. Additional rain and storm chances early next week may result in an upward trend in river levels.

  • WHAT: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ast.

  • WHERE: Minnesota River at Savage.

  • WHEN: Until further notice.

  • IMPACTS: At 702.0 feet, Barge loading affected at Port Cargill, and other flood prevention measures are begun. Water begins to impact Black Dog Road in Burnsville.

  • ADDITIONAL DETAILS:

    • At 800 PM CDT Thursday, the stage was 702.6 feet.
    • Recent Activity: The maximum river stage in the 24 hours ending at 800 PM CDT Thursday was 702.8 feet.
    • Forecast: The river is expected to fall below flood stage early Saturday morning and continue falling to 699.0 feet Thursday, June 20.
    • Flood stage is 702.0 feet.
    • Flood History: This crest compares to a previous crest of 702.7 feet on 04/28/1995.
